Susceptibility of Ocular <i>Staphylococcus aureus</i> to Antibiotics and Multipurpose Disinfecting Solutions
<i>Staphylococcus aureus</i> is a frequent cause of ocular surface infections worldwide. Of these surface infections, those involving the cornea (microbial keratitis) are most sight-threatening. <i>S. aureus</i> can also cause conjunctivitis and contact lens-related non-infec...
